If your marriage cannot be salvaged but you don’t want to go through the time, expense and emotional difficulties of a long and protracted legal battle, you may want to consider the collaborative divorce process. In collaborative divorce, both parties retain legal counsel but also agree to try to resolve all disagreements in the divorce without the intervention of the judge or the court. Parties in collaborative divorce often seek input from other experts, such as family counselors or financial advisors, to iron out their differences. If you reach an impasse and need to seek a decision from the court, both parties must end their relationship with their existing counsel and hire a new lawyer.
